KENNETH E. WELTZIN <br />County Engineer <br />PHYLLIS F. SPECKER <br />Administrative Assistant <br />November 29, 1978 <br />Office of <br />Ramsey County Engineer <br />City of Little Canada <br />Attention Mr. Joseph Chlebeck <br />515 Little Canada Road <br />Little Canada, Minnesota 55117 <br />502 Courthouse <br />St. Paul, Minnesota 55102 <br />Telephone (612) 2984127 <br />Policy for Lighting County Roadways <br />At its meeting November 28, the Board of County Commis- <br />sioners adopted Resolution 78 -1394 establishing a new <br />policy for lighting county roadways to be effective <br />January 1, 1979. The policy describes the locations <br />where the County will normally furnish energy costs for <br />warranted lights (designated Al through B7 in the policy). <br />Enclosed is a copy of our letter to the Northern States <br />Power Company requesting discontinuation of service <br />effective January 1, 1979, to the road lights not covered <br />by the policy. <br />A copy of the inventory of street lights in your munici- <br />pality is enclosed, also. The discontinued lights are <br />indicated on the street light inventory by a circle of <br />the identification number. <br />'Kenneth E. Weltzin; P.
